What Engineering Considerations Go Into Making the Handle Both a Pull Grip and Throttle Control?

Introduction: When Function Meets Form

Designing an electric smart suitcase like the Airwheel SE3SX isn’t just about packing in tech—it’s about rethinking how travelers interact with their luggage. One of the most innovative features is the dual-function handle: it serves as both a traditional pull grip and the throttle control for motorized movement. But how do engineers make this possible without compromising comfort, safety, or usability? Let’s break down the key considerations.

Ergonomic Integration for Dual Use

The handle must feel natural whether you’re walking with your luggage or riding it. Engineers focus on grip shape, material texture, and pivot angle to ensure comfort during extended pulling. At the same time, embedded sensors detect thumb pressure to activate the motor—light squeeze for slow start, firmer press for acceleration. This analog input mimics motorcycle throttles but is tuned for pedestrian speeds (up to 9.9 km/h on the SE3SX), ensuring intuitive control without sudden jerks.

Safety-First Electronics Design

Since the same handle controls propulsion, fail-safes are critical. The system uses momentary contact switches—meaning the motor only runs while pressure is applied. Release your thumb, and the suitcase stops within seconds. There’s no cruise control mode, reducing risks in crowded spaces like airports or train stations. All electrical components, including the 73.26Wh lithium battery (designed to meet airline carry-on limits), are sealed and isolated from mechanical stress points to prevent short circuits or overheating.

Mechanical Durability Under Mixed Loads

The handle assembly must withstand repeated pulling forces (often over 10 kg of packed weight) while protecting delicate electronics inside. Reinforced polymer joints and internal metal supports distribute stress away from sensor housings. On models like the SE3SX (weighing just 6.6 kg), structural balance ensures that motor torque doesn’t twist or warp the frame during use. The telescoping shaft also maintains alignment whether upright or tilted, preserving smooth rolling and precise directional control via the handlebar.

User Experience Without Dependency on Apps

While the Airwheel app allows optional features like ride mode selection or Find My integration (using Apple’s network for location tracking), the core function—riding via the handle—is completely standalone. No Bluetooth pairing or phone required. This independence ensures reliability: even if your phone dies, the suitcase remains functional as both a rider and roller.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I use the suitcase normally if the battery is dead? Yes. With a dead or removed battery, the SE3SX works like a standard carry-on—pull it by the handle or roll it smoothly on its wheels.Is the 73.26Wh battery allowed on airplanes? Yes. Most airlines permit lithium batteries under 100Wh in carry-on luggage. The SE3SX’s removable battery complies with these rules, making it safe for international travel.Does riding damage the suitcase over time? No. The design accounts for regular riding. Components are tested for thousands of cycles, and the lightweight build (6.6 kg for SE3SX) reduces strain on joints and motors during daily use.
